Output 31fd625de68b900fee0cdcfd470eefd7ece752f1e6229fd7dfa91446b9c418bf:1

value
933588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c36e8fce845090df51aa7cb69a6804a8802aba3 OP_EQUALVERIFY OP_CHECKSIG
address
16VPKjQP2fczMvSQjX2oypx3W2DapNekgW
transaction
31fd625de68b900fee0cdcfd470eefd7ece752f1e6229fd7dfa91446b9c418bf
confirmations
490607
spent
true